PartnerRe appoints actuarial officer
PartnerRe Ltd. yesterday announced the appointment of Costas Miranthis to the position of Chief Actuarial Officer.
Mr. Miranthis will have overall responsibility for the company's actuarial function and risk management, including oversight of the Company's reserve setting and capital allocation processes. He will be based in Bermuda and report to Albert Benchimol,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er.
Mr. Miranthis holds a MA in Economics from Christ's College, Cambridge University, UK. He is a Fellow of the Institute of Actuaries and a Member of the American Academy of Actuaries.
Since 1997, he has been a principal with the leading international actuarial consulting firm, Tillinghast-Towers Perrin in London, UK, where his responsibilities have included managing the European non-life business, and its mergers and acquisitions practice in Europe.

PartnerRe Ltd. is a leading global reinsurer, providing multi-line reinsurance to insurance companies through its wholly owned subsidiaries, Partner Reinsurance Company, PartnerRe US and PartnerRe S.A. Risks reinsured include property, catastrophe, agriculture, motor, casualty, marine, aviation/space, credit/surety, technical and miscellaneous lines, life/annuity and health. As of March 31, 2002, total assets were $7.6 billion, total capitalisation was $2.4 billion and total shareholders' equity was $1.8 billion.
